Answer
Put the kitten back in with the mother. Some mothers will move their babies on their own for whatever reasons. If you have a male cat that is not neutered it is possible for him to have taken the kitten and killed it. Sometimes they do that for reasons I won't go into here. Cats move their kittens by grabbing them at the back of the neck (the scruff) with their mouths and carrying them to the new places, places she feels are safer.


You need to just let the Mom be with her baby and when that baby is 6 weeks old you should get the mom neutered too (and the male should be done now) so she doesn't have any more kittens.
